Amateur Mannat Brar sets early pace at BPGC leg of Hero WPGT

Pune amateur Mannat Brar on her way into the day one lead at the Hero Women’s Pro Golf Tour event in Mumbai on Tuesday. Image courtesy WGAI.

By Rahul Banerji

National champion Mannat Brar held a two-shot lead after the first round of the fourth leg of the Hero Women’s Pro Golf Tour at Bombay Presidency Golf Club on Tuesday.

Mannat, who will represent India at the Women’s Amateur Asia-Pacific Championships in Vietnam next week, looked set for a low round as she was four-under after 12 holes.

Three bogeys between holes 14 and 17 though saw her fall back before she finished with a birdie on 18th for a 2 under par 68, the WGAI said.

Kriti Chowhan, Seher Atwal and Shweta Mansingh were tied for second on level par 70.

The highlight of Shweta’s round was a hat-trick of birdies from 15 to 17 as she tallied four birdies against as many bogeys.

Seher, a past winner on the Tour, had two birdies and two bogeys while Kriti Chowhan also had a similar card.

Solid record

The 17-year-old Mannat, who last year became the first Indian to reach the semi-finals of the R&A Girls Amateur, is also the All India Amateur and Junior Girls Championship winner.

She birdied the first, fourth and sixth holes to turn in 3-under and added a fourth birdie on 12.

Bogeys on holes 14, 15 and 17, however pulled the Pune amateur back before she closed with a birdie on 18.

The crowded leader board had a five-way tie for fourth place on 2 over 72 including 2024 Hero Order of Merit winner, Hitaashee Bakshi, last week’s runner-up Vani Kapoor, Neha Tripathi, Jasmine Shekar and amateur Anuradha Chaudhuri.

Six others led by Sneha Singh, winner last week in Pune, amateurs Saanvi Somu, Keerthana Rajeev and Aradhana Manikandan besides Ananya Datar and Lavanya Jadon were tied for 10th on 3 over 73s.

Ridhima Dilawari (74) was T-16, Gaurika Bishnoi and Khushi Khanijau (75 each) were T-21, Amandeep Drall (76) was T-23, and Rhea Purvi (77) was T-25.
